There’s a reason why we call it our Annual Trout Kicking Expedition besides the 
time I tripped over a rainbow. In the upper mile & a half, when the water’s low 
enough to wade, there can be twenty to thirty fish using you as a current 
break. If you stand still too long, the larger fish will bump your ankles 
trying to get you to move so you’ll turn the rocks. Last year the water was 
high most of the time & except for one day the only time we could wade was from 
5 AM until 7 or 7:30. Still caught lots of fish, so you should have fun. Watch 
for the fish slappers in the outlets near the dam, you’ll know what I’m talking 
about when you see them.

"FISHING HAS A REPUTATION as an innocuous, fairly mindless pastime enjoyed most 
by shiftless people. Perhaps that impression would be lessened if nonfishers 
understood more about wild water. Calling fishing a hobby is like calling brain 
surgery a job. The average visitor driving through Yellowstone sees no farther 
than the surface of the water. At best the lakes and streams are mirrors 
reflecting the surrounding scenery. For the alert fisherman, especially the fly 
fisherman, the surface is not a mirror but a window. " Paul Schullery  
"Mountain Time"
